In mathematics, theta functions are special functions of several complex variables. They appear in various topics, including Abelian varieties, moduli spaces, quadratic forms, and solitons. As Grassmann algebras, they appear in quantum field theory.

Power series for the cotangent and cosecant functions can be expressed rather compactly in terms of the Riemann zeta and Dirichlet eta functions:

\[ \displaystyle \cot z = -2 \sum_{k=0}^\infty \frac{ \zeta(2k) }{ \pi^{2k} } z^{2k-1} \hspace{5em}
\csc z = 2 \sum_{k=0}^\infty \frac{ \eta(2k) }{ \pi^{2k} } z^{2k-1} \]

Since I haven't seen these expressed quite this way before, I thought I'd share it. More information is available here:

In a turning process modeled using delay differential equations (DDEs), we investigate the stability of the regenerative machine tool chatter problem. An approach using the matrix Lambert W function for the analytical solution to systems of delay differential equations is applied to this problem and …
